The Economic Benefits of Regionalisation
A report recently prepared by SC Lennon & Associates, presents the
findings of a study commissioned by RDA Far North to consider and
assess the potential economic impacts of regionalisation of government
services to the Far North Region of South Australia. The analysis is
informed by an overview of current thinking / arguments for regionalisation
in Australia, some assumptions about what quantum of government
departments might potentially re-locate to the Far North from Adelaide and
elsewhere and economic modelling of the potential impacts. Click here for
the full report or here for the summary report.
Isaac Region Business Connection Scoping Study
A report prepared by SC Lennon & Associates, presents the findings of a
study commissioned by Greater Whitsunday Alliance (GW3) to explore the
concept of a regional business association, one which would represent and
support all businesses in all industries across the Isaac region. Informed by
research, consultation with the Isaac region’s businesses and lessons from
case studies of regional business associations operating elsewhere in
Australia, the Isaac Region Business Connection Scoping Study report
recommends the establishment of a new regional, independent, apolitical
representative business body to advocate on behalf of all businesses
across the Isaac region. Download the report here.

South Australian Government Commits to Sealing First Section of Outback Strzelecki Track
The Strzelecki Track in outback South Australia is set to be partly sealed as a first step to creating an almost continuous stretch of tarmac between Queensland and Western Australia. Analysis undertaken by SC Lennon & Associates showed sealing the 472-km unsealed road has the potential to generate economic benefits in the order of between $2.3 billion and $3.1 billion. Queensland Local Content Model - Redefining 'Local' for Regional Areas
With the assistance of SC Lennon & Associates, Queensland Local Content Leaders’ Network (QLCLN) and Greater Whitsunday Alliance have led the development of a new model of local procurement that is more relevant and fair for regional areas and also redefines the definition of ‘local’.
